centerBREAKINGIsraeli soldiers suspected of raping Palestinian detainee allowed to return to service

NEWS SUMMARY
Israeli army chief Eyal Zamir authorized the return to reserve duty of five soldiers suspected of torturing and raping a Palestinian detainee at Sde Teiman detention center in 2024. Charges against the soldiers were dropped last month, with no internal military investigation conducted despite leaked surveillance footage of the alleged abuse.
